Rowing Report - Henley Women's Regatta

20 June 2023

This year, we sent two girls crews to compete at Henley Women’s regatta where top crews from schools, clubs and universities from across the world come to compete on the prestigious Henley Course from 16 to 18 June.  

The J16 4+ of Cleo Gregory, Ella Murray, Amalie Finch, Mia Garvey and Lily Nguyen raced on Friday evening to qualify for the heat stages.  The girls really raised their game with one of their best efforts this season and although they managed to beat crews that they had lost to in recent regattas they missed out on the top 8 by just seconds, coming 10th out of the field of 20.

The Girls’ Championship 2x of Florence Carter and Maisie Humphrey were more experienced having raced over the course last year; they looked commanding in their qualifying race on Saturday morning and their strong performance achieved them a place in the first heat that afternoon against Bewl Bridge Rowing Club.  After overcoming some steering issues in the early stages of the race Florence and Maisie showed their experience and grit by staying in contact with their opposition down the length or the course, keeping Bewl Bridge under pressure.  In the final stages of the race, a  determined push by the girls enabled them to row through taking the win in the last 200m and putting them into the quarter finals against Club Nautico, Seville on Sunday morning.   

The quarter final saw the Seville crew take an early lead along Temple Island, but again Florence and Maisie stayed in touch whilst underrating their opposition.  They continued to push the Spanish double all along the course but this time, they were not quite able to get back on terms, eventually losing by just 1 length. 

Well done girls for putting in a great performance over the weekend.
